Schneider's Introduction to Programming Using Visual Basic is a current and comprehensive introduction to visual basic programming. It has been consistently praised in the industry since 1991 and is a favorite of instructors and students. Schneider discusses problem-solving techniques early and uses them throughout the book. He also ensures each chapter is rich yet concise by developing chapters around crucial subjects rather than covering too many topics superficially.

The 11th Edition is updated for Visual Basic 2017, providing an ideal tool for students learning their first programming language. The text keeps pace with modern programming methodology while incorporating current content and good programming practices.
